CF1899A Game with Integers

Description

Vanya and Vova are playing a game. Players are given an integer $ n $ . On their turn, the player can add $ 1 $ to the current integer or subtract $ 1 $ . The players take turns; Vanya starts. If after Vanya's move the integer is divisible by $ 3 $ , then he wins. If $ 10 $ moves have passed and Vanya has not won, then Vova wins. Write a program that, based on the integer $ n $ , determines who will win if both players play optimally.

Input Format

The first line contains the integer $ t $ ( $ 1 \leq t \leq 100 $ ) — the number of test cases. The single line of each test case contains the integer $ n $ ( $ 1 \leq n \leq 1000 $ ).

Output Format

For each test case, print "First" without quotes if Vanya wins, and "Second" without quotes if Vova wins.
